4. What are the common features of international student health insurance plans available in Cameroon?

Common features of international student health insurance plans available in Cameroon typically include:

1. Coverage for medical expenses: International student health insurance plans in Cameroon usually provide coverage for a range of medical expenses, including hospitalization, doctor visits, laboratory tests, medications, and surgeries.

2. Emergency medical evacuation: Many plans include coverage for emergency medical evacuation to a facility that can provide appropriate care if the student’s condition is critical and cannot be adequately treated in Cameroon.

3. Repatriation of remains: In the unfortunate event of a student’s death while studying in Cameroon, international student health insurance plans often include coverage for the repatriation of remains to their home country.

4. 24/7 assistance services: These plans typically offer round-the-clock assistance services, such as a helpline for medical emergencies, access to multilingual staff, and help in finding healthcare providers.

Additionally, some international student health insurance plans in Cameroon may offer optional coverage for dental care, mental health treatment, maternity care, and coverage for pre-existing conditions after a waiting period. It is important for students to carefully review the policy details, exclusions, and limitations to ensure they have comprehensive coverage during their stay in Cameroon.

10. What is the cost of international student health insurance in Cameroon?

The cost of international student health insurance in Cameroon can vary depending on various factors such as the duration of coverage, the coverage limits, the insurance provider, and the specific benefits included in the policy. On average, international student health insurance in Cameroon can range from XAF 50,000 to XAF 200,000 per year. It is essential for international students to carefully review different insurance plans available in Cameroon to ensure that they are adequately covered for medical expenses during their stay. Some insurance providers offer comprehensive health insurance packages tailored specifically for students studying abroad, which may include coverage for medical emergencies, doctor visits, hospitalization, prescription medications, and other healthcare services. It is advisable for international students to compare different insurance options and select a plan that meets their specific needs and budget.

15. Are there any exclusions or limitations to be aware of with international student health insurance in Cameroon?

When it comes to international student health insurance in Cameroon, there are certain exclusions and limitations that students should be aware of to ensure they have a clear understanding of their coverage. These exclusions and limitations can vary depending on the insurance provider and policy chosen, but some common ones include:

1. Pre-existing conditions: Many international student health insurance plans may exclude coverage for any pre-existing medical conditions that the student had before purchasing the insurance policy.

2. High-risk activities: Some insurance companies may not provide coverage for injuries sustained during certain high-risk activities such as extreme sports or adventure activities.

3. Non-emergency care: Certain policies may limit coverage to emergency medical care only, excluding coverage for routine doctor’s visits or elective procedures.

4. Mental health coverage: Some insurance plans may have limited coverage for mental health services, counseling, or therapy sessions.

5. Dental and vision care: Coverage for dental and vision care may be limited or excluded from certain international student health insurance plans.

It is crucial for international students in Cameroon to thoroughly review the terms and conditions of their health insurance policy to understand any exclusions or limitations that may apply, and to ensure they have appropriate coverage for their specific healthcare needs while studying abroad.
